Autonomic cardiovascular tests in children with obstructive sleep apnea syndrome

Children with obstructive sleep apnea (OSA) show increased sympathetic activity and impaired cardiovascular responses during wakefulness. These autonomic dysfunctions correlate with OSA severity, impacting overall cardiovascular health.

Area of Science:

  • Pediatric cardiology
  • Autonomic nervous system function
  • Sleep medicine

Background:

  • Obstructive sleep apnea (OSAS) is increasingly recognized in children.
  • Autonomic nervous system (ANS) dysfunction is a potential complication of OSAS.
  • Understanding cardiovascular autonomic activity in children with OSAS is crucial for risk assessment.

Purpose of the Study:

  • To investigate cardiovascular autonomic activity during wakefulness in children diagnosed with OSAS.
  • To assess autonomic function using standardized cardiovascular tests.
  • To correlate autonomic parameters with the severity of OSAS.

Main Methods:

  • Prospective study involving 25 children with OSAS and 25 age-matched healthy controls.
  • Overnight polysomnography to diagnose OSAS.
  • Autonomic cardiovascular tests (Ewing test battery: head-up tilt, Valsalva maneuver, deep breathing test).

Main Results:

  • Children with OSAS exhibited higher blood pressure, resting heart rate, and altered responses during tilt and deep breathing tests compared to controls.
  • A significant inverse correlation was found between the apnea-hypopnea index (AHI) and cardiovascular autonomic function tests (30:15 index, Valsalva ratio).
  • Increased AHI correlated positively with blood pressure changes during autonomic testing.

Conclusions:

  • Children with OSAS demonstrate heightened basal sympathetic activity during wakefulness.
  • Impaired cardiovascular autonomic responses are evident and linked to OSAS severity.
  • Findings suggest a significant impact of OSAS on the pediatric autonomic cardiovascular system.

Sleep apnea is a condition where breathing stops intermittently during sleep, often leading to significant health issues. Each episode can last from 10 to 20 seconds or more and is frequently accompanied by a brief arousal from sleep. This disturbance, largely unnoticed by the individual, can lead to severe daytime fatigue. Commonly, individuals seek help after being informed by their partners about loud snoring and noticeable breathing pauses during sleep.
